Step 2 — Find the right influencers (quality over follower count)
-
Use these quick filters:
-
Relevance: Do they post about your niche? (food, tech, beauty, entrepreneurship)
-
Engagement: Look at comments and meaningful interactions, not just likes.
-
Audience: Are followers local (Nigeria, city) if you sell locally?
-
Content style: Are they storytellers, educators, or entertainers — which fits your offer?
-

Step 4 — Plan the collab content & CTA
-
Decide content format: short video, carousel, live session, story + swipe up (or link), or WhatsApp CTA.
-
Make the CTA ridiculously easy: “Send ‘JOIN20’ to WhatsApp +234…”, “Click link to register”, or “Use code [NAME20]”.
-
Give influencers creative freedom but include mandatory points:
-
Offer headline
-
How to claim (exact CTA)
-
Your tracking link or code
-
Time window (e.g., 7 days)
-
Real-life example: An influencer posts a 60-second demo + story directing followers to message the biz on WhatsApp using keyword “HUBENT20” — messages collected become leads.

Step 6 — Track leads and respond fast
-
Use a simple spreadsheet or CRM to list incoming leads (name, phone, message, source).
-
Track source by code or by asking the lead “How did you hear about us?” — ideally capture the influencer handle.
-
Respond within hours — faster responses = higher conversion. Use WhatsApp templates for quick replies.
Simple tracking example:
-
Column A: Lead Name | B: Phone | C: Offer Code | D: Influencer Source | E: Status (Contacted, Interested, Closed)
Step 7 — Measure ROI & iterate
Key metrics:
-
Leads generated per influencer
-
Conversion rate (lead → sale)
-
Cost per lead (if paying influencer) or value of barter
-
Lifetime value (LTV) of leads
Iterate: Keep the top 20% of influencers who gave you the best cost-per-conversion. Scale those relationships into ongoing partnerships.

5 FAQs (and short answers)
1) How much should I pay an influencer in Nigeria in 2026?
There’s no one-size answer. Micro-influencers often accept products or small fees and have higher engagement. Measure by cost per converted lead rather than follower count. Start with test campaigns before scaling.
2) What’s the fastest way to collect leads from an influencer post?
Use a WhatsApp keyword (e.g., “HUBENT20”) and ask leads to message that number. It’s immediate, familiar, and converts better than email in many Nigerian markets.
3) How do I track which influencer produced each lead?
Give each influencer a unique promo code or tracking link OR ask incoming leads “Which influencer referred you?” and log it in your lead sheet.
4) Are influencer collabs worth it for small budgets?
Yes — if you choose niche, engaged micro-influencers and pair the collab with an irresistible short-term offer and fast follow-up, ROI can beat broad paid ads.
